COLOMBO, Nov. 2 (Xinhua) -- Sri Lanka's support for the Belt and Road Initiative is a clear indication that Sri Lanka-China relations will only be further strengthened, an expert said on Friday.

Director General of the Institute of National Security Studies Sri Lanka Asanga Abeyagoonasekera said that Sri Lanka with its geo-strategic position will be a "super-connector" in the Indian Ocean and on the maritime silk road.

Proposed by China in 2013, the Belt and Road Initiative refers to the Silk Road Economic Belt and the 21st Century Maritime Silk Road, aiming at building a trade and infrastructure network connecting Asia with Europe and Africa along the ancient trade routes of Silk Road.

Abeyagoonasekera recently visited the 8th Beijing Xiangshan Forum which was held in Beijing with more than 500 participants from over 70 countries and international organizations.
